THE LOCATION

This home is located in the traditional seaside town of Lowestoft. This wonderful seaside destination is steeped in history and offers a delightful blend of coastal allure and urban convenience. With its Blue Flag award-winning sandy beaches, Victorian seafront gardens and two charming piers, residents are treated to strolls along the shore and tranquil moments amidst nature's beauty. There are a number of schools in the area to suit all ages, a range of amenities including a Post Office, Bus Station and Train Station, which both run regular services to Norwich and plenty of shopping facilities and restaurants.
